Position: Intern - Architectural Design - Summer 2026 at HNI Corporation

Your Impact Starts the Day You Do! What We Need:

We are looking for an Architectural Design Intern to join our Architectural Products team in Muscatine, IA during Summer 2026!

What You Will Do:

HNI’s summer internship program is a great opportunity for first‑hand experience in your field of interest. You'll work on one or more projects that create value for our business partners. HNI's large, paid internship program includes exposure to leadership, professional development opportunities (Lunch and Learns, training, skill building workshops), support through a mentor relationship, volunteering, and social events!

Company-paid apartment‑style housing may also be available, based on student's geographic need and current housing capacity. Depending on the flexibility of the role, the intern may have the opportunity to work a hybrid schedule.

The Architectural Products team is responsible for providing design services focused on architectural products to our external and internal users. As an intern on this team, you will work cross‑functionally with dealers, designers, product development engineers, and more to deliver design solutions. We will assign you projects that are critical to company success and aligned with your individual interests. Our interns are a key source of future talent for entry‑level careers.

What

You Have:
  • Candidates should be working towards a Bachelor's degree in Interior Design, Architecture or related field. Junior level coursework is preferred.
  • Working knowledge of Revit, AutoCAD, and Sketch Up
  • Portfolio containing examples of design work must be submitted
  • Preference will be given to applicants with relevant work experience, internships, or involvement in related activities such as tutoring or business fraternities.
What You're Good At:
  • Self‑starter with high personal motivation and desire to take initiative and ownership
  • High attention to detail
  • Strong experience managing projects (school or work related)
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Dedicated team‑player, strong communication, interpersonal and time‑management skills
